#5fad4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5fad4c is composed of 37.3% red, 67.8%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 108.2 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 48.8%. #5fad4c color hex could be obtained by blending #beff98 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#5fad4c color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#5fad4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5fad4c has RGB values of R:95, G:173,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 6270284.

Shades and Tints of #5fad4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050904 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.
